Building Strong Health With Smart Care Habits

Health care has become a fundamental aspect of modern life, encompassing physical, mental, and emotional well-being. It involves a combination of preventive measures, medical interventions, lifestyle choices, and self-care practices that maintain the body’s optimal function. Maintaining good health requires awareness, discipline, and the ability to adapt routines to meet individual needs. Each choice, from diet and exercise to sleep and stress management, plays a crucial role in promoting longevity, preventing disease, and improving the overall quality of life. Understanding how to balance these factors is essential for creating a sustainable approach to health that supports both immediate wellness and long-term vitality.

Nutrition forms the foundation of health https://freesmoke.co.uk/ care, providing the essential fuel and nutrients the body needs to function efficiently. A balanced diet that includes a variety of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, lean proteins, and healthy fats supplies v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ants necessary for cellular repair, immune support, and energy production. Proper hydration is equally important, as water regulates body temperature, supports digestion, and aids in the elimination of toxins. Mindful eating and understanding portion control can prevent chronic diseases such as diabetes, heart disease, and obesity while promoting a healthy metabolism.

Regular physical activity is another key component of health care, supporting cardiovascular health, muscular strength, flexibility, and mental well-being. Engaging in consistent exercise, whether through aerobic activities, strength training, or mobility-focused practices, enhances blood circulation, strengthens bones, and boosts mood by releasing endorphins. Exercise also plays a preventive role, reducing the risk of lifestyle-related illnesses and improving overall energy levels. Incorporating movement into daily routines, even in small amounts, can have significant long-term benefits for both physical and mental health.

Sleep and stress management are often overlooked but are critical to maintaining a balanced health care regimen. Adequate sleep allows the body to repair tissues, consolidate memory, and regulate hormones that influence appetite, mood, and energy. Chronic sleep deprivation can increase susceptibility to infections, metabolic disorders, and mental health issues. Similarly, managing stress through relaxation techniques, meditation, mindfulness, or hobbies reduces the negative impact of cortisol on the body, improves focus, and supports emotional stability. Integrating strategies that promote rest and mental clarity ensures the body and mind function optimally.

Preventive health measures, including regular medical check-ups, vaccinations, screenings, and early detection practices, are vital for maintaining long-term wellness. Consulting healthcare professionals for guidance and monitoring health markers helps identify potential issues before they escalate. Preventive care empowers individuals to make informed decisions and adopt lifestyle adjustments tailored to their unique needs.

Mental health care is increasingly recognized as an integral part of overall well-being. Prioritizing emotional and psychological health through therapy, social support, and self-reflection improves resilience, coping mechanisms, and overall life satisfaction. A holistic approach that combines mental, physical, and emotional health creates a foundation for a more balanced, fulfilling life.

Modern health care emphasizes proactive, mindful practices that integrate lifestyle management, medical guidance, and emotional support. By understanding the interconnectedness of nutrition, exercise, sleep, stress management, preventive care, and mental health, individuals can cultivate long-term wellness, resilience, and vitality that sustain a vibrant, healthy life.
